1.4.17 Morning Love

~ a poem ~

You’re beautiful when you wake up.
Sleep crusted corners of your eyes
Rank breath
Hand over your mouth, giggling
“Ugh, don’t. Gross. Not yet.”
“Don’t care.”
You’re beautiful when you wake up.

You’re beautiful when you wake up.
Hair mushed
Pink pillow lines on your face
Stiff neck waiting for my skilled hands
And that groan as your whole body
tenses, then relaxes.
You’re beautiful when you wake up.

You’re beautiful when you wake up.
Dried drool painting roots on your chin
Scratchy voice not yet warmed up
“Hey you.”
“Morning love.”
You’re beautiful when you wake up.
